E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
泛型类
【Java】泛型 之 擦拭法
例如,我们编写了一个
泛型类
Pair,这是编译器看到的代码:publicclassPair{privateTfirst;privateTlast;publicPair(Tfirst,Tlast){this
iHero
·
2023-09-22 17:18
Java
学习
java
开发语言
Java泛型详解
这种参数类型可以用在类、接口和方法中,分别被称为
泛型类
、泛型接口、泛型方法。二、泛型的作用泛型的好处是在编译的时候检查类型安全,并且所
梦想不会灭
·
2023-09-22 17:47
Java学习笔记
java
泛型
【Java】泛型 之 编写泛型
写
泛型类
比普通类要复杂。通常来说,
泛型类
一般用在集合类中,例如ArrayList,我们很少需要编写
泛型类
。如果我们确实需要编写一个
泛型类
,那么,应该如何编写它?可以按照以下步骤来编写一个
泛型类
。
iHero
·
2023-09-22 17:45
Java
学习
java
开发语言
Java 泛型
泛型的理解和好处传统方式用泛型来解决前面的问题(快速入门)泛型的好处泛型基本语法泛型介绍示例代码泛型的声明泛型的实例化(什么时候给泛型指定一个具体的类型)-一般来说是创建一个对象的时候指定的示例代码泛型语法和使用泛型使用案例自定义泛型自定义
泛型类
自定义泛型接口自定义泛型方法泛型的继承和通配符补充
Kim-Hyunyeon
·
2023-09-22 09:02
阶段1:Java入门
java
intellij-idea
开发语言
2023_Spark_实验八:Scala高级特性实验
1、什么是
泛型类
和Java或者C++一样,类和特质可以带类型参数。
pblh123
·
2023-09-21 11:47
Scala
spark
scala
大数据
【Swift】泛型常见使用
1、Swift泛型4种泛型函数
泛型类
型泛型协议泛型约束//泛型函数定义式func函数名(形参列表)->返回值类型{//函数体...}2、泛型约束3种继承约束:
泛型类
型必须是某个类的子类类型协议约束:
泛型类
型必须遵循某些协议条件约束
文子飞_
·
2023-09-21 08:36
java学习笔记 - 第15章:泛型
第15章:泛型总体内容泛型generic泛型的理解和好处泛型介绍泛型语法泛型应用实例泛型细节课堂练习自定义泛型自定义
泛型类
自定义泛型接口自定义泛型方法泛型继承和通配符引申:JUnit使用(单元测试框架)
王胖子嘤
·
2023-09-20 21:39
java基础学习笔记
java
学习
单元测试
Java学习笔记day17-泛型-Set
Day17泛型泛型概述泛型:是JDK5中引入的特性,它提供了编译时类型安全监测机制泛型的好处:把运行时期的问题提前到了编译期避免了强制类型转换泛型可以使用的地方:类后面,这样的类称为
泛型类
方法申明上,这样的方法称为泛型方法接口后面
猫薄荷>3<
·
2023-09-20 21:38
笔记
java
Java学习Day08------泛型、Set集合、二叉树
泛型、Set集合、二叉树泛型
泛型类
泛型方法泛型接口类型通配符Set集合TreeSet二叉树二叉查找树平衡二叉树泛型(1)概念:表示集合中存储的数据类型(2)好处: a)把运行时期的问题提前到了编译期间
挨踢农民工dsh
·
2023-09-20 21:37
JavaSE学习
java
Java
泛型类
(接口,方法)使用
原本情况下,ArrayList中是Object类型对象:ArrayList list=newArrayList();如果里面是基本类型int,当我们对里面元素进行求和时,只能对元素进行强制转换,泛型的使用,可以很好的解决上述问题:1.泛型的定义ArrayListlist=newArrayList{privateEa;publicvoidtest(Em){this.a=m;System.out.pr
提着小灯找呀找
·
2023-09-20 21:34
java
jvm
开发语言
Java基础 —— 泛型(三)方法、接口、数组
Java基础——泛型(三)泛型方法泛型方法是指在方法中使用
泛型类
型参数的方法,它可以在方法调用时确定类型参数的类型。
能量老8
·
2023-09-20 21:33
java
开发语言
Java 泛型方法/接口、泛型限定
一、为什么要定义泛型方法1、从
泛型类
到泛型方法的演变过程我们先来看个例子//定义一个
泛型类
,并定义如下两个方法classTest{ public voidshow(Tt){ System.out.println
CodingALife
·
2023-09-20 21:02
Java基础详解
Java基础 —— 泛型(二)限制类型参数
这样做可以确保
泛型类
型参数具有某些特定的属性或行为。下面是一个使用extends关键字限制类型参数的例子:publicclassBox{privateTdata;publicBox(Tdat
能量老8
·
2023-09-20 21:32
java
java
架构
后端
Java进阶使用记录
Javacategories:Javacover:https://cover.pngfeature:true文章目录1.Asset断言1.1IDEA开启assert1.2assert使用2.泛型2.1定义和使用
泛型类
Fan
·
2023-09-20 19:42
Java
java
开发语言
Java 泛型
也就是说在泛型使用过程中,操作的数据类型被指定为一个参数,这种参数类型可以用在类、接口和方法中,分别被称为
泛型类
、泛型接口、泛型方法。
vcaml7717
·
2023-09-20 11:42
Java笔记
java
TypeScript逆变 :条件、推断和泛型的应用
“创建一个
泛型类
型Test,以确保这两个参数之间存在约束关系就完事了,睡醒再说”,就这样暗忖着,又昏昏沉沉睡过去,只有那Textendsunknown[]闯入我梦中,飘忽不定,若即若离,暗示着我再次翻车
·
2023-09-18 18:09
程序员
[Kotlin] 泛型实例化
那么下面来看一下Kotlin具体要怎么做吧,首先我们必须阻止泛型擦除:inlinefunnew():T通过inline和reifiied可以保证
泛型类
型被实化,这是实例化的基础,接着就可以写以下代码:inlinefunn
何晓杰Dev
·
2023-09-17 17:26
第十三章总结
一.泛型1.定义
泛型类
泛型机制语法:类名其中,T是泛型的名称,代表某一种类型。
偷訫
·
2023-09-17 10:08
windows
网络
【Java 基础篇】Java类型通配符:解密泛型的神秘面纱
它使得我们能够更加灵活地处理
泛型类
型,使代码更通用且可复用。本文将深入探讨Java类型通配符的用法、语法和最佳实践。什么是类型通配符?类型通配符是一个用问号?
繁依Fanyi
·
2023-09-16 11:16
Java
进击高手之路
java
开发语言
后端
前端
git
github
ide
详解Typescript中的泛型
我们可以使用或其他标识符作为
泛型类
型参数,并在函数参
大莲芒
·
2023-09-15 05:00
typescript
javascript
前端
初始
泛型类
泛型的顶级理解一.包装类1.基本数据类型和对应的包装类2.装箱和拆箱3.自动装箱和拆箱二.泛型1.语法2.
泛型类
的使用3.示例4.擦除机制5.泛型上界6.示例和复杂示例7.泛型方法一.包装类在Java中
骑乌龟追火箭1
·
2023-09-15 01:05
数据结构
【Java面试突击-2】Java基础(中)
Class对象2,判断是否为某个类的实例3,创建实例4,获取类方法5,获取类的成员变量(字段)信息6,调用方法反射的缺点泛型什么是泛型如何实现泛型的类型擦除Java编译器处理泛型的过程泛型使用方式1,
泛型类
df007df
·
2023-09-14 12:16
java基础
Java面试突击
java
基础
面试
泛型内容总结
认识泛型泛型指的是,在定义类,接口和方法时,同时声明了一个或多个变量,如:,称为
泛型类
,泛型接口,泛型方法。泛型是JDK1.5新增的特性,是一种在编译时期进行类型检查和类型推断的特性。
@泡芙不能掉队
·
2023-09-14 11:25
java
开发语言
包装类和认识泛型
目录一、包装类1.1基本数据类型和对应的包装类1.2装箱和拆箱1.3自动装箱和自动拆箱二、泛型概念及引出2.1泛型概念2.2泛型引出三、
泛型类
的使用四、裸类型(了解)五、泛型如何编译5.1擦除机制5.2
羽翼~
·
2023-09-14 11:43
数据结构
java
面试
java 栈 队列 回文_用栈和队列判断输入字符串是否是回文(回文具有两边对称的性质)...
由于我使用的是.net里面自带的Queue,Stack,他们都是
泛型类
型,初始化:Queu
钢的美少女
·
2023-09-14 10:49
java
栈
队列
回文
JAVA中的泛型
目录泛型泛型的语法:
泛型类
基本数据类型和对应的包装类泛型方法:语法:小结:如下是定义了一个类,这个类中可以存放一组int类型的数据。
休息一下…
·
2023-09-14 05:36
算法
开发语言
java
java Consumer接口与示例
使用示例代码1:示例代码2:示例代码3:示例代码4:二、BiConsumer使用示例代码一:示例代码二:三、其他和Consumer相关的接口Java8中的Consumer是一个函数接口,它可以接受一个
泛型类
型参数
西凉的悲伤
·
2023-09-13 14:50
java
java
Consumer接口
Consumer
consumer
java
Consumer
8.4 Kotlin泛型
编译时间检查:在编译时检查泛型代码,以便在运行时避免任何问题
泛型类
像java一
AlfredZSGao
·
2023-09-13 06:33
F#奇妙游(31):数据缺失的处理
FSharpOption是一个
泛型类
型,它有两个值:Some和None。Some表示一个值,而None表示一个缺失的值。
大福是小强
·
2023-09-12 20:52
F#
F#
函数式编程
.NET
开发语言
算法
为什么除了null外,任何元素不得添加到上<? extends T>
使用
泛型类
型参数限定为时,我们无法确定实际类型参数是什么。这意味着我们只能安全地读取该类型的数据,但不能写入除了null以外的任何元素。
mywaya2333
·
2023-09-12 12:25
服务器
linux
java
【数据结构】包装类&简单认识泛型
文章目录1包装类1.1基本数据类型和对应的包装类1.2装箱和拆箱2什么是泛型3引出泛型3.1语法4
泛型类
的使用4.1语法4.2示例4.3类型推导(TypeInference)5泛型的上界5.1语法5.2
Mang go
·
2023-09-12 11:15
数据结构
java
面试
Java泛型原理篇: 类型擦除以及桥接方法
专栏文章导航Java泛型入门篇:
泛型类
、泛型接口以及泛型方法Java泛型进阶篇:无界通配符、上界通配符以及下界通配符Java泛型原理篇:类型擦除以及桥接方法文章目录前言1.类型擦除无界擦除上界擦除下界擦除
笔墨桑
·
2023-09-11 18:15
泛型
泛型
python转c++语言_C++和Python的数据类型的相互转换
方法呢不仅仅可以满足int型数据相加,同样也能支持其他类型的相加,既然是这样,那在示例工程中的PyInvoker中就没必要也不可能为每一种数据类型都建立一个函数来完成加法功能,所以这里就分享下使用C++的泛型函数,
泛型类
和泛型特化来完成相应功能
weixin_39874269
·
2023-09-11 18:02
python转c++语言
Java中的泛型
泛型一、.概述二、自定义泛型结构1.自定义泛型结构2.自定义泛型结构:
泛型类
、泛型接口3.自定义泛型结构:泛型方法三、泛型在继承上的体现四、通配符的使用通配符的使用:有限制的通配符一、.概述所谓泛型,就是允许在定义类
~四时春~
·
2023-09-11 11:58
Java专栏
java
Java基础二十七(泛型)
泛型擦除泛型一般有三种使用方式:
泛型类
、泛型接口、泛型方法。publicclassTyp
写代码的小包
·
2023-09-11 05:14
Java
java
开发语言
Java泛型
文章目录一、简介二、类型参数化1.声明
泛型类
和接口2.
泛型类
型参数的命名规范3.类型参数的限定和约束三、泛型方法1.定义和使用泛型方法2.泛型方法与重载的关系3.泛型方法的类型推断机制四、通配符与边界1
皮卡冲撞
·
2023-09-09 02:18
java
python
开发语言
泛型
【C++】模板template
当使用一个vector这样的
泛型类
型时,
林 子
·
2023-09-08 22:56
小林的C++之路
c++
开发语言
一文了解Java泛型
1.为什么需要泛型2.
泛型类
型2.1.
泛型类
2.2.泛型接口3.泛型方法4.类型擦除5.泛型和继承6.类型边界7.类型通配符7.1.上界通配符7.2.下界通配符7.3.无界通配符7.4.通配符和向上转型
昵称有多帅
·
2023-09-08 17:43
day32 泛型 数据结构 List
一、泛型概述JDK1.5同时推出了两个和集合相关的特性:增强for循环,泛型泛型可以修饰
泛型类
中的属性,方法返回值,方法参数,构造函数的参数Java提供的
泛型类
/接口Collection,List,Set
别挡
·
2023-09-07 21:22
API文档
java
Java泛型详解
文章目录01什么是泛型02
泛型类
泛型类
的使用泛型的派生子类03泛型接口04泛型方法05类型通配符06类型擦除07泛型和数组08泛型和反射01什么是泛型泛型产生的背景:Java推出泛型以前,是构建一个元素类型为
苗半里
·
2023-09-07 20:16
Java学习
java
jvm
开发语言
【JavaSE】- 5min拿下泛型!
泛型1.1泛型的定义1.2泛型细节2.1
泛型类
2.2泛型方法2.3泛型接口2.4泛型的通配符1.1泛型的定义泛型的介绍提供了编译时类型安全检测机制泛型的好处把运行时期的问题提前到了编译期间避免了强制类型转换
难吃的茄子
·
2023-09-07 18:59
java
List系列集合、泛型、Set系列集合、Collection系列集合使用场景总结
目录List系列集合LinkedList集合遍历可能存在的问题泛型
泛型类
的概述泛型方法的概述泛型接口通配符Set系列集合HashSet集合LinkedHashSet集合TreeSet集合Collection
奇见疯
·
2023-09-07 14:57
list
java
重走安卓进阶路——泛型
泛型类
、泛型接口和泛型方法(
泛型类
和泛型接口的定义与泛型方法辨析);如何限定类型变量?泛型使用中的约束和局限性;
泛型类
型能继承吗?泛型中通配符类型;虚拟机是如何实现泛型的?
小呀么小黄鸡
·
2023-09-07 14:32
集合的笔记
集合包装类
泛型类
有一个不幸的限制,不能使用基本类型作为类型参数,解决办法是使用这个包装类,每一种基本类型都有对应的包装类基本类型和它们对应的包装类型之间的转换是自动进行的。
TranquilGlow
·
2023-09-07 11:54
#
java基础笔记
笔记
java
Redis中 StringRedisTemplate 和 RedisTemplate 对比分析
第二点,RedisTemplate是一个
泛型类
,而StringRedisTemplate则不是。
爱穿衬衫的张某某
·
2023-09-07 06:49
【每日面试】Java中的ThreadLocal
查看JDK的api手册,发现ThreadLocal是lang包下的一个
泛型类
,从1.
BCS-点心
·
2023-09-07 01:37
每日面试题
java
面试
JavaEE基础——泛型
泛型类
publicclassTest1{Listlist;//不是范型方法Tget1(Tt){returnt;}//不是范型方法Kget2(Kk,Vv){System.out.println(v);returnk
Alex_yuan666
·
2023-09-06 20:58
Java基础
java
泛型
泛型
泛型类
是在实例化类的时候指明泛型的具体类型泛型方法是在调用方法的时候指明泛型的具体类型泛型方法中是用来声明该方法是泛型方法,只有使用了声明的方法才能叫泛型方法表明该方法将使用
泛型类
型T,此时才可以在类中使用
泛型类
型
苦茶般人生
·
2023-09-06 12:48
C#之泛型
目录一、概述二、C#中的泛型继续栈的示例三、
泛型类
(一)声明
泛型类
(二)创建构造类型(三)创建变量和实例(四)比较泛型和非泛型栈四、类型参数的约束(一)Where子句(二)约束类型和次序五、泛型方法(一
互联网底层民工
·
2023-09-06 10:37
C#
c#
开发语言
【C#】泛型
泛型特点提高代码重用性一定程度避免装箱拆箱泛型分类声明
泛型类
基本语法:class类名声明泛型结构基本语法:struct结构名声明泛型接口基本语法:interface接口名声明泛型函数基本语法:函数名(参数列
WilhelmLiu
·
2023-09-04 17:33
C#知识模块
c#
开发语言
上一页
7
8
9
10
11
12
13
14
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他